The Essential Guide to Wooden Baby Cots: Durability, Safety, and StyleWhen it comes to getting ready for the arrival of a new baby, among the most considerable investments parents make remains in a crib. Among the myriad options available, wooden baby cots stand out for their sturdiness, visual appeal, and safety functions. In this article, we will check out the advantages of wooden baby cots, what to look for when buying one, and address some often asked questions to help you make an informed decision.Why Choose Wooden Baby Cots?Wooden baby cots have gotten enormous appeal amongst parents for several reasons. Here are the most notable advantages:1. SturdinessWood is renowned for its strength and longevity. A sound wooden cot can last for years, even through multiple kids. This toughness frequently makes wooden cots an affordable option in the long run.2. SecurityWhen it comes to security, wooden cots are typically a safer choice compared to their metal equivalents. High-quality wooden cots are tough, offering a secure sleeping environment that lowers the danger of tipping over. Furthermore, wooden cots can be completed with non-toxic paints or varnishes, making sure that the crib is safe for your baby.3. Visual AppealWooden cots have an organic, classic appearance that fits perfectly into numerous nursery styles. They can be easily painted or stained to match your design, permitting modification that adds a personal touch.4. Eco-FriendlinessFor environmentally-conscious parents, wooden baby cots made from sustainably sourced wood can be a greener alternative. Lots of brands now highlight environmentally friendly practices in their production procedures.Secret Features to Consider in Wooden Baby CotsWhen picking a wooden baby cot, a number of functions should be taken into account to guarantee you are making the ideal choice for your family. Here's a list of important features to consider:1. Product QualityKinds of Wood: Options consist of solid wood (like oak, maple, or beech) and composite materials.End up: Ensure that the finish is non-toxic and safe for babies.2. Style and SizeConvertible Options: Many wooden cots are created to transform into toddler beds or daybeds, permitting the cot to grow with your child.Area: Measure your nursery to ensure the cot will fit properly without overwhelming the space.3. Security StandardsCertification: Look for cribs that satisfy safety standards set by organizations like the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) or the American Society for Testing and Materials (ASTM).Non-toxic surfaces: Ensure the wood is treated with safe materials, securing your child from harmful chemicals.4. AdjustabilityMattress Height: Cots with adjustable mattress heights can adapt as your baby grows, making it simpler for you to take your baby in and out of the crib.5. Rate and Brand ReputationPurchasing a trusted brand can guarantee you get a premium product.
